Capran® MT1000 Film
Polymer Name: BOPA (Nylon) Film
Processing Methods: Film Extrusion, Extrusion
Physical Form: Film
Capran® MT1000 film is a 0.40 mil (10 micron) biaxially oriented Nylon 6 film with a metallized barrier coating by controlled vacuum deposition of high-purity aluminum. The metallized film has corona treatment on the reverse side. Capran® MT1000 film not only maintains its physical properties, but also offers exceptional gas barrier and a pure glossy metallic appearance, making it especially well-suited for packaging and balloon applications.

Aegis® PIR-H120ZP
Polymer Name: Polyamide 6 (PA 6)
Labeling Claims: Recycled, Contains PIR Resin, Sustainable
Processing Methods: Extrusion, Cast Film Extrusion, Blown Film Extrusion, Film Extrusion
Density: 1130.0 - 1130.0 kg/m³
Aegis® PIR-H120ZP resin from AdvanSix contains 100% post-industrial recycled (PIR) raw materials while providing the same top performance and processability as Aegis® H120ZP, its standard, non-recycled counterpart.Aegis® PIR-H120ZP resin is a high viscosity, nylon 6 extrusion grade homopolymer for cast or blown film applications. It combines strength, toughness and thermoforming properties with excellent heat, chemical and abrasion resistance.

Aegis® PIR-H35ZI
Polymer Name: Polyamide 6 (PA 6)
Additives Included: Lubricant (Unspecified)
Labeling Claims: Sustainable, Recycled, Contains PIR Resin
Processing Methods: Injection Molding
Density: 1120.0 - 1120.0 kg/m³
Aegis® PIR-H35ZI resin from AdvanSix contains 100% post-industrial recycled (PIR) raw materials while providing the same top performance and processability as Aegis® H35ZI, its standard, non-recycled counterpart.Aegis® PIR-H35ZI resin is an unfilled, low viscosity, non-lubricated nylon 6 injection molding homopolymer exhibiting excellent melt flow properties for filling thin sections and reduced cycle times. Aegis® PIR-H35ZI homopolymer exhibits good strength, stiffness and toughness as well as excellent heat, chemical and abrasion resistance.
